my main fuel line has a pin-sized hole in it. i am going to replace it with -6AN SS line. now can i run the line from the fuel pump to the fuel filter without any problems?

do i need to run bulkheads when the line transitions through the chassis and then again when it goes through the firewall?

also, is it necessary to run the stock "2-way valves" or can i run a hose end banjo fitting on each end?

Remember that Aeroquip is heavy, so do consider replacing the stock line.

You do not need bulkhead fittings for SS hose, but you would need quality gromets. SS Hose is very abrasive and saws through anything so it will make unprotected hols bigger over time. If you can afford the bulkhead fittings, go for it.

Remeber to clamp that hose down securely and in numerous locations.
